The job market in Marathon, Florida

With data compiled from reliable public sources and government organizations like the Bureau of Labor Statistics and the U.S. Census Bureau, Joblift provides you with essential insights to help you in your job search in Marathon, FL.

In Marathon, a diverse array of industries contributes to the flourishing local economy. From hospitality and retail sectors catering to visitors and residents alike, to construction projects constantly shaping the cityscape, opportunities for growth abound. Technology and science play significant roles, pushing the boundaries of innovation while health care services ensure the wellbeing of the community. With such a strong foundation in various sectors, Marathon offers an appealing landscape for jobseekers seeking new professional horizons.

In the city, employment opportunities present an enticing prospect to job seekers. With an average salary of $110,485, which is 59.60% above the national average, residents can expect a higher income compared to other locations across the nation. The cost of living, however, stands at about 35.0% higher than average, indicating that daily expenses may be on the pricier side in this urban environment. Approximately 28% of individuals enjoy health insurance coverage through their employers, offering some level of financial security related to healthcare needs. As for commuting, it only takes an average of 13 minutes to reach one's place of work, making transportation within the city efficient and time-saving.

Marathon, FL exhibits a favorable employment landscape with its current unemployment rate of 3.30%, which is below the national average of 3.8%. The city's economy demonstrates resilience and stability, contributing to a positive environment for jobseekers. As Marathon's future job market growth is anticipated to be modest, it suggests steady opportunities for individuals seeking employment in this area.
